Output f21c4eeeff0cf5178a80c8b60d0b74b5d4d314aa94792fa572dfb0571a9584b7:0

value
266996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4584af6c51bf4f29a91db96a4b02b1e527b454a OP_EQUAL
address
3J8bKmQdPgy1tdbhvF1YxfaMxXgb9XcQpZ
transaction
f21c4eeeff0cf5178a80c8b60d0b74b5d4d314aa94792fa572dfb0571a9584b7
spent
true